Alan Carr performed a secret gig at Walthamstow’s Rose and Crown last night in front of around 100 excited audience members.

The monthly comedy night held at the pub is no stranger to big names but the secrecy surrounding this performance was a first.

Pub staff were told he’s likely to do a repeat show there in the future.

Bun Constantinou, manager, said: “Those who didn’t know he was coming on were thrilled.

“There’s been brilliant feedback, he was pleased with how it went as was the audience.

“Everyone I’ve talked to enjoyed the show, it’s done well for the local community – local people were able to get their hands on the tickets.”

Carr, 36, host of TV show Chatty Man, was testing out new material before an upcoming comedy tour.
